If you ignore warnings and download "nequi glitch apk 60.0" from an unofficial source, here is what is statistically likely to happen:
Banking trojans often request permission to read your SMS messages. Even if you have 2FA enabled, the malware will intercept the verification code and automatically forward it to the attacker, allowing them to complete the theft in real-time. The specifics of Nequi's terms of service and
Modern banking apps do not store your balance solely on your phone. Your phone is just a viewer. Your real balance is stored on Grupo Bancolombia’s secure servers.
